Output 69d4186a1fb7fcbe26001fc40d01430c50059d393e5e84952a6beb6f4a346dbf:0

value
20319931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86444fe615edbcd6f1fcead13d41ee72a747d0e OP_EQUAL
address
3QLPcxw1pUXP471GALkuh5iVWB2ZBx9m4n
transaction
69d4186a1fb7fcbe26001fc40d01430c50059d393e5e84952a6beb6f4a346dbf
confirmations
255873
spent
true